"What’s in the box?" Se7en is a master class in setup and payoff, and the final scene helped make a connect-the-dots police procedural an instant classic. But that ending that never would have happened if the studio had their way.

Our CineFix series, Art of the Scene, takes on the ultimate unboxing that shocked viewers. Everything from the camera movements to the way Kevin Spacey highlights specific words bring out the artistry of the scene and evoke unease as we watch Detective Mills unravel.
